S.H.OUT stands for Students Helping Out.
This is a club I started a few months ago, comprised of about 30 kids from my school. We work together on projects to better our own community, but have also reached out to global causes.
Our club has been very successful for the small amount of time it has existed. Our projects include making blankets out of fabrics scraps and donating them to a local homeless shelter, holding a bake sale and donating the proceeds to Feed the Children, and hosting a school dance to benefit the Rainforest Action Network.
More is on the way though. We hope to host a yard sale and donate the proceeds to local animal shelters, and we will also hold a sign up sheet for students interested in participating in the March of Dimes, which benefits research on helping premature babies.
